Transaction ecbc5dd77ccfc5ae51550645824a5f9d4b076a9f365d438cba383fe78bbc7a75
1 Input
1 Output
-
ecbc5dd77ccfc5ae51550645824a5f9d4b076a9f365d438cba383fe78bbc7a75:0
- value
- 4505456
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21533e2c13af6f67d14c8084334467a756e832f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 143D29TCKCCj4x4A1kQVKdei94VNXGe98v